    • A method for purifying gaseous or liquid effluents containing sulphur derivatives (H2S, alkylmercaptans, SO2), wherein (i) the effluent to be processed is alkalised to a pH greater than 9 in the presence of a base of general formula M-OH, wherein M is an alkali metal, an alkaline-earth metal, a condensation agent between the organic portion of the compound of formula (I) below and the sulphur derivative, or a phase transfer agent, particularly a quaternary ammonium or a ligand; and (ii) the product from (i) is contacted with a compound having general formula X-(CH2)n-CO-R (I), wherein X is a halogen; a sulphonyl halide of formula X'-SO2-R', where X' is halogen and R' is a C1-20 alkyl group or an optionally substituted aryl group; or an OH group; R is C1-16 alkoxy, a group NH-R", where R" is a hydrogen atom or a primary or secondary amine radical; an OR2 group where R2 is a hydrogen atom, an alkali metal, an alkaline-earth metal or an ammonium group; or halogen; and n is a number from 1 to 4; at a temperature of 12-95 DEG C and under atmospheric pressure.

    • The present invention is directed to a formulation and associated method for neutralizing one or more toxic chemical and/or materials including toxic industrial chemicals and toxic industrial materials, such as irritants, heavy metals, radioactive metals, acids and acid irritants, pesticides, and various agricultural chemicals, (collectively referred to as toxic chemical, materials, or simply toxins) as well as decontaminating surfaces that have come into contact with these agents. As a result, the formulation of the present invention can be used for neutralizing a broad spectrum of toxic chemicals and materials. In one embodiment, the active ingredient comprises 2, 3, butanedione monoxime (also known as diacetyl monoxime (DAM)), and alkali salts thereof such as potassium 2,3-butanedione monoxime (KBDO). The formulation also typically includes a carrier in which the active ingredient is dispersed. In one embodiment, the carrier comprises polyethylene glycol (PEG); monomethoxypolyethylene glycol(mPEG); and combinations and derivatives thereof.

    • The invention relates to a polyoxometalate topical composition for removing a contaminant from an environment, comprising a topical carrier and at least one polyoxometalate, with the proviso that the polyoxometalate is not H5PV2Mo10O40; K5Si(H2O)Mn W11O39; K4Si(H2O)Mn W11O39; or K5Co W12O40. The invention further relates to a method for removing a contaminant from an environment by the composition and contacting a polyoxometalate powder or a polyoxometalate coating with the environment. It further relates to a modified polyoxometalate, comprising the admixture of (1) a polyoxometalate and (2) a cerium, a silver, a gold, a platinum compound, or a combination thereof. The invention further relates to a method for removing a contaminant from an environment by contacting a modified material comprising (1) a material and (2) a metal compound comprising a transition metal compound, an actinide compound, a lanthanide compound, or a combination thereof, wherein the metal compound is not a polyoxometalate. The modified material comprises (1) a material comprising a topical carrier, a powder, a coating, or a fabric, and (2) a metal compound comprising a transition metal compound, an actinide compound, a lanthanide compound, or a combination thereof, wherein the metal compound is not a polyoxometalate. The invention further relates to an article comprising the modified material.
